K.J. and Lynn Pugh are soon moving to Boroughbridge, a town in rural North Yorkshire to serve Grace Church, a fledgling church plant with the goal of planting multiple gospel communities. They are moving so K.J. can step into the pastor role there so the current pastor can move to France to continue the same work, but for the first year, they need to raise support. 
 
The purpose of this video is to raise awareness of the gospel need in North Yorkshire, of what K.J. and his family are doing, of their need for prayer and financial support, and to challenge believers to consider going to a place like North Yorkshire that desperately needs christians to go and simply live lives changed by the gospel.

I didn't shoot the majority of the footage—I only shot K.J.'s interview and the english breakfast scene. The majority of the footage came from Lynn Pugh, who is a talented photographer new to shooting video. Lynn did a great job shooting b-roll around the town and capturing Del's interview. 
 
Additional footage from England and France came from videos created by The Crowded House. 
 
Footage of the american church, Summit Crossing, is courtesy of Matthew Wilson, Creative Director at Summit.
 
The Yorkshire Bound logo was designed by Olivia Pugh.
Footage was assembled and cut in Premiere Pro. Color grading was done in Speedgrade and Colorista II. Audio was mixed in Audition. Graphics were animated in After Effects.
